When Alex’s husband Ryan decided to take on The Knowledge, the famously gruelling test required to become a licensed London black cab driver, he had no idea how deeply it would test his patience, focus, and resilience. In this honest conversation, Alex and Debs sit down with Ryan to explore why he chose this unique path, what it took to get through years of studying every street in London, and how the process affected his mental health, family life, and sense of purpose. Welcome to the very first episode of Heart Full, Mind Heavy: North & South Unfiltered where two friends from opposite ends of the UK get real about the mental load of modern motherhood. In this episode, we’re diving straight into the chaos: juggling work, raising kids, running a business and somehow still being expected to drink enough water and “make time for ourselves.” Spoiler alert: it’s a lot.
